Output d21354fcdcb94f52d2794e9bf468c46357e26f32c22e828e3c664c4243393260:0

value
608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25acb66400acd5b27a061293f5894fa895a952b OP_EQUAL
address
3LsGbLpnyzhLCwJZquQzZ2h7XHsuHVvceR
transaction
d21354fcdcb94f52d2794e9bf468c46357e26f32c22e828e3c664c4243393260
spent
true